Criminals can sometimes be crafty with how they attempt to cover up their tracks, but very few would expect Mountain Dew to be a potential DNA remover. That said, a Florida woman has been recently sentenced to 35 years for the second-degree murder of her roommate. The murderer, Nichole Maks, was also charged with tampering with evidence. Police reported that she drenched herself in Mountain Dew to remove DNA traces from her body, the blood of her dead 79-year-old roommate.

Florida police found Maks a few hours after midnight, suspiciously walking about while covered in blood and holding a knife and hammer. According to Local 12, she claimed to have been homeless for years but knew the victim in question, her deceased elderly roommate. It goes without saying that the police didn’t buy her answers and took her in for questioning. During the interrogation, she asked for a can of Mountain Dew, but instead of drinking it, she proceeded to pour the soda all over herself until the officers restrained her.
